    Darker, Smokey Eyes Proven to Draw Men

    Posted September 1, 2009 by ritika
    Found in: Beauty Tips & Secrets

     

    I read in Cosmo this month that, according to one study by MIT, men are are naturally more attracted and drawn to women whose eyelids are darker than the rest of their face. It’s really the only form of makeup that guys care about–so you should accentuate your eyes to look darker and deeper.

    Dark eyelids are associated with femininity. That’s why the smokey eye look is always so sultry.

    You might have thought that guys typically like the natural beauty–and this is true as well. Apart from the exaggeratedly luscious eyes, guys don’t like it when you overdo the foundation. A little goes a long way.

    Also, if you notice, your eyelids are actually naturally a darker shade than the rest of your face in natural light as well. But, it only adds to the effect to use smokey eye makeup. You can stick to the traditional black palettes, but the attraction still works if you opt for fun colors–as along as you coat a dark layer around your eyes first to set the right tone.

    I’ve found that Stila’s smokey eye palette is all you need. It’s $40 at Sephora and there are a variety of color schemes available. Sephora’s website even has an audio for instructions.

     Sandy Allen - Deceased - The world's tallest woman - Afrobella

    Rest in peace Sandy Allen! :) The world’s tallest woman recent passed away at the age of 53 …

    “At age 10, Sandy Allen was 6 foot 3. By sixteen, she had crested 7 feet. At her tallest she was 7 feet, 7 inches tall and was recognized as the world’s tallest female. She passed away today, at the age of 53.

    In 1974, she wrote to Guinness World Records in an effort to befriend someone she could identify with.

    “It is needless to say my social life is practically nil and perhaps the publicity from your book may brighten my life,” she wrote.

    I guess the recognition brought her out of her shell. According to the AP, Allen came to celebrate her height, and she “appeared on television shows and spoke to church and school groups to bring youngsters her message that it was all right to be different.”

    (Source: Afrobella Blog)
